The Super Bowl is a great excuse for many people to shamelessly stuff their face full of football food.
Coffee tables across North America will be piled up with fatty, salty, sweet and spicy goodies.
But just how much work will it take to burn it all off?
Three fried mac and cheese balls add up to more than 1,500 calories. You would have to run 249 football fields to burn that off, according to Dr. Charles Platkin the Diet Detective.
Wash those down with six beer, at 145 calories each, and you would have to do the wave 280 times.
Three pigs in a blanket, at 66 calories each, adds up to 68 minutes of catch, non stop, with the pigskin.
Three slices of meat lovers pizza will have you "Tebowing" for 1,220 minutes.
One hot wing with blue cheese dip will bring out your artistic side as you face painting 8 wild fans.
A typical meat laden take out sub, is 313 minutes of chanting, pointing and waving giant foam finger.
Bring out the pom-poms because a single deviled egg is worth 12 minutes of cheer leading.
10 classic potato chips with French onion dip could equal 134 minutes of dancing to Madonna during the half time show.
